What is a 20 Foot Container?
A 20-foot container, frequently referred to as a TEU (Twenty-foot Equivalent Unit), is a basic 20' Shipping Container container utilized for carrying items around the world. Its dimensions make it versatile for numerous kinds of cargo, including palletized goods, vehicles, machinery, and basic materials.
Requirements of a 20 Foot Container
The following table describes the essential requirements of a standard 20 Container Size-foot container:
DimensionMeasurementExternal Length20 foot container size ft (6.058 m)External Width8 ft (2.438 m)External Height8.5 ft (2.591 m)Internal Length19.4 ft (5.898 m)Internal Width7.7 ft (2.352 m)Internal Height7.9 ft (2.385 m)Maximum Gross Weight24,000 kg (52,910 pounds)Tare Weight2,300 kg (5,071 lbs)Payload Capacity21,700 kg (47,851 lbs)Volume33.1 cubic metersDesign Variants

What can fit inside a 20-foot container?
A 20-foot container can typically hold about 10-11 basic pallets or approximately 21,700 kg of cargo depending upon the type of items being shipped.
2. Just how much does a 20-foot container weigh?
The tare weight of a basic 20-foot container is around 2,300 kg (5,071 lbs).
